Senior Software Developer - Backend
Frontier Resourcing
4 days ago
Role details
Contract type
Temporary cont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
SeniorJob location
Remote
Tech stack
Java
JavaScript
Activiti (Software)
Agile Methodologies
Amazon Web Services (AWS)
Apache Ant
Unit Testing
Business Process Model and Notation
Software Debugging
DevOps
Gradle
JUnit
Maven
Open Source Technology
Openshift
Red Hat Enterprise Linux - RHEL
Mockito
Test Driven Development
React
Spring-boot
Cypress
Backend
GIT
Vue.js
Angular
Kubernetes
Atlassian Tools
Build Tools
Front End Software Development
Software Version Control
Docker
Go
Job description
My client is looking for a Senior Software Developer with backend experience including Golang and Java. This role you will be joining a growing Consultancy who work with Central Government departments on a range of projects.
Requirements
Do you have experience in Vue.js?, * Demonstrable experience designing, coding and debugging Golang based systems
- Demonstrable experience working on Agile environments
- Demonstrable experience working on product development environments based on observation, experimentation and user research
- Demonstrable experience working in multi-disciplinary/DevOps teams which include product owner/manager, UX designers, UX researchers, Developers, Platform engineers, etc
- Golang
- Java
- Spring Boot
- Docker
- Kubernetes
- Atlassian
- Build tools: Maven, Gradle, Ant
- Familiar with source control systems, such as GIT, including branching, merging, etc
- Testing: TDD, unit testing, JUnit, Mockito, Cypress
Desirable skills:
- AWS
- Knowledge of Open Source BPMN workflow engines (Camunda, Activiti or Flowable)
- Experience on a front-end javascript framework such as react, angular or vue.js
- RedHat OpenShift for container orchestration